Bindahalli is a village situated in Pandavapura taluka of Mandya district in Karnataka.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 346 families residing in the village Bindahalli. The total population of Bindahalli is 1,498 out of which 764 are males and 734 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Bindahalli is 961.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Bindahalli village is 143 which is 10% of the total population. There are 80 male children and 63 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Bindahalli is 788 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(961) of Bindahalli village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Bindahalli is 61.2%. Thus Bindahalli village has a lower literacy rate compared to 63.7% of Mandya district. The male literacy rate is 68.86% and the female literacy rate is 53.35% in Bindahalli village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 6.3%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0% of total population in Bindahalli village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Bindahalli village out of total population, 456 were engaged in work activities. 99.1%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 0.9%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 456 workers engaged in Main Work, 379 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 3 were Agricultural labourers.
